Revolution in our lifetime

Danny Meadows-Klue, chief executive of the Interactive Advertising Bureau (a think tank and trade association for the commercial interactive industry), traces the short history of the web, and shows how in ten years it has changed the way consumers (and marketers) behave, gather information and buy.

Ten years ago there were no websites: no web addresses, no 24- hour online shopping, no sporting highlights on broadband, no free email, no chat, no search. 'Online' meant nothing, 'URL' was meaningless and an @ symbol on a business card was ridiculed as a typo.
